ABSTRACT

BACKGROUND: Living alone may be associated with greater risk for social isolation and loneliness. Living alone, social isolation, loneliness, and limited engagement in social activity have all been associated with poorer cognitive function in later life. Hence, if individuals who live alone are also at greater risk of isolation and loneliness, this may exacerbate poor cognitive function. OBJECTIVE: To determine whether people living alone are more at risk of social isolation, feelings of loneliness, and limited social activity, and to examine the associations between living alone and cognitive function in later life. METHOD: Baseline (N = 2197) and two-year follow-up (N = 1498) data from community-dwelling participants, age ≥65 years, without cognitive impairment or depression at baseline from CFAS-Wales were used. Linear regression analyses were conducted to assess the association between living arrangement and cognitive function at baseline and two-year follow-up. RESULTS: People living alone were more isolated from family and experienced more emotional loneliness than those living with others, but were not more isolated from friends, did not experience more social loneliness, and were more likely to engage in regular social activity. Living alone was not associated with poorer cognitive function at baseline or two-year follow-up. DISCUSSION: These findings have positive implications and suggest that people who live alone in later life are not at greater risk of poor cognitive function at baseline or two-year follow-up. Social isolation may be more associated with poor cognitive function.

ABSTRACT

Objectives: Poor social connections may be associated with poor cognition in older people who are not experiencing mental health problems, and the trajectory of this association may be moderated by cognitive reserve. However, it is unclear whether this relationship is the same for older people with symptoms of depression and anxiety. This paper aims to explore social relationships and cognitive function in older people with depression and anxiety. Method: Baseline and two-year follow-up data were analysed from the Cognitive Function and Ageing Study-Wales (CFAS-Wales). We compared levels of social isolation, loneliness, social contact, cognitive function, and cognitive reserve at baseline amongst older people with and without depression or anxiety. Linear regression was used to assess the relationship between isolation and cognition at baseline and two-year follow-up in a subgroup of older people meeting pre-defined criteria for depression or anxiety. A moderation analysis tested for the moderating effect of cognitive reserve. Results: Older people with depression or anxiety perceived themselves as more isolated and lonely than those without depression or anxiety, despite having an equivalent level of social contact with friends and family. In people with depression or anxiety, social isolation was associated with poor cognitive function at baseline, but not with cognitive change at two-year follow-up. Cognitive reserve did not moderate this association. Conclusion: Social isolation was associated with poor cognitive function at baseline, but not two-year follow-up. This may be attributed to a reduction in mood-related symptoms at follow-up, linked to improved cognitive function.

ABSTRACT

BACKGROUND: There is some evidence to suggest that social isolation may be associated with poor cognitive function in later life. However, findings are inconsistent and there is wide variation in the measures used to assess social isolation. OBJECTIVE: We conducted a systematic review and meta-analysis to investigate the association between social isolation and cognitive function in later life. METHODS: A search for longitudinal studies assessing the relationship between aspects of social isolation (including social activity and social networks) and cognitive function (including global measures of cognition, memory, and executive function) was conducted in PsycInfo, CINAHL, PubMed, and AgeLine. A random effects meta-analysis was conducted to assess the overall association between measures of social isolation and cognitive function. Sub-analyses investigated the association between different aspects of social isolation and each of the measures of cognitive function. RESULTS: Sixty-five articles were identified by the systematic review and 51 articles were included in the meta-analysis. Low levels of social isolation characterized by high engagement in social activity and large social networks were associated with better late-life cognitive function (r = 0.054, 95% CI: 0.043, 0.065). Sub-analyses suggested that the association between social isolation and measures of global cognitive function, memory, and executive function were similar and there was no difference according to gender or number of years follow-up. CONCLUSIONS: Aspects of social isolation are associated with cognitive function in later life. There is wide variation in approaches to measuring social activity and social networks across studies which may contribute to inconsistencies in reported findings.

ABSTRACT

There is evidence to suggest that social isolation is associated with poor cognitive health, although findings are contradictory. One reason for inconsistency in reported findings may be a lack of consideration of underlying mechanisms that could influence this relationship. Cognitive reserve is a theoretical concept that may account for the role of social isolation and its association with cognitive outcomes in later life. Therefore, we aimed to examine the relationship between social isolation and cognition in later life, and to consider the role of cognitive reserve in this relationship. Baseline and two year follow-up data from the Cognitive Function and Ageing Study-Wales (CFAS-Wales) were analysed. Social isolation was assessed using the Lubben Social Network Scale-6 (LSNS-6), cognitive function was assessed using the Cambridge Cognitive Examination (CAMCOG), and cognitive reserve was assessed using a proxy measure of education, occupational complexity, and cognitive activity. Linear regression modelling was used to assess the relationship between social isolation and cognition. To assess the role of cognitive reserve in this relationship, moderation analysis was used to test for interaction effects. After controlling for age, gender, education, and physically limiting health conditions, social isolation was associated with cognitive function at baseline and two year follow-up. Cognitive reserve moderated this association longitudinally. Findings suggest that maintaining a socially active lifestyle in later life may enhance cognitive reserve and benefit cognitive function. This has important implications for interventions that may target social isolation to improve cognitive function.
